Abstract

The method of semantic structuring of virtual community content has been developed in the paper on the example of web-forums. Virtual communities have been analyzed as an important means of communication on the internet for the purpose of scientific, educational and professional activities. Online communication web-forums are a convenient form of knowledge acquisition in communities. Semantic structuring of knowledge bases is an important and critical factor for easy navigation and search. However, the size of today’s popular web forums does not allow doing this manually. For this purpose, it is necessary to develop automated tools of content restructuring. Application of the developed method of automated content restructuring by administrators has resulted in improvement of content structure. This method can be applied to modify the structure of sites, web forums and other forms of communities.
